- Ensure the correct version of PLC code is installed and modified to match the FDS for the system.
- Test and prove all safety systems are operational.
- Program all relevant sensors to enable the system to function as required.
- Install the correct version of software and prove that all functionality is available.
- Assist with the commissioning of external suppliers equipment and confirm integration into Cargo products.
- Establish safe exclusion zones for testing equipment.
- Prove the performance of the system does match performance criteria outlined in the FDS.
- Support the customer Factory Acceptance Test.
- Support the customer Site Acceptance Tests.
- Work with QA to resolve any quality issues.
- Work with suppliers to correct any defects found during commissioning.
- Experience with IFM CodeSys platform and Allen Bradley RS Logix is preferred.
- The ability to work with others in a multi-disciplinary, fast-paced product development environment
- Experience of design for manufacture, with a background in a production environment would be highly desirable.
- Energy, drive and a can do attitude are essential for this position
- The individual will be expected to travel extensively overseas to commission products on site and support customer SAT's.
- Whilst not travelling, you will commission products at our site in Stoke-on-Trent.
